secn+ crew - Burch Antley pbp & Trey Dyson color.
Antley's West Columbia born & bred. graduated Batesburg-Leesville High. attended USC, graduated Newberry. he called Batesburg-Leesville HS football on radio forever.
Burch started doing radio at WBLR in Batesburg SC at age 15. this is a funny listen for Gamecocks who haven't heard much about Burch and his career path. talks about his time at Carolina & how he finished his degree at Newberry.
Trey's from Columbia too. played for Ray. 2002 SEC male scholar athlete of the year.
